Operating Scenarios
The IT Managers have a very large number of information about systems they manage: the network management software, hardware and management applications allows you to know better the operations made by your own systems and their status. To take major decisions (such as those involving systems migration, DBMS upgrades or doing away with e-xpensive servers) require focus. IT Managers need to be in a position to assess the impact of major change on both business outcomes and on budget (via a cost/benefit analysis). Moreover, with systems often outsourced to third parties, management still bears the onus of strategic planning.
